eCTC Implementation Project in Pennsylvania – Updates on training with Social Development Research Group (SDRG) and PA trainees

Project Overview/Update:

This project is designed to implement the eCTC curriculum with 20 coalition sites and to train a cadre of 7 coaches over the next 3 years; Round One Roll Out has defined the sites listed below as the first sites to be trained on the materials; (F) = site currently funded through PCCD; (M) = mature sites that are not currently receiving funding through PCCD and are revitalizing their CTC focus

eCTC Project Notes:

  • “PA Mobilizer” = “eCTC Facilitator”: The eCTC curriculum has the Facilitator conducting the trainings utilizing the video-based curriculum with guidance from EPISCenter staff and the Coaching Cadre
  • Coaching Cadre: This is a group of 7 individuals (3 are EPISCenter staff) who will be coaching the eCTC sites through the process utilizing the eCTC curriculum; each coach must first facilitate a coalition through the process utilizing the eCTC curriculum
  • eCTC Sites will have special access to eCTC materials found on the site

Activities To Date:

  • July 2015 – Contract began with eCTC developers at the Social Development Research Group (SDRG) at the University of Washington
  • July 27-29, 2015 – 1st eCTC Facilitator Training held – Harrisburg
  • This first training was conducted by SDRG Coaches, Dalene Dutton and Blair Brook-Weis; this first training was designed to train EPISCenter staff and potential coaches and to begin conversation around the roll out of the project

  • Participants worked through the prescribed Facilitator Training and began discussions around the responsibilities of the external members of the coaching cadre and overall project development
  • September 2015 – Identified Sites and Coaches to be included in the Round One Roll Out Project
  • EPISCenter worked with PCCD to identify sites and coaches that will be part of the Round One Roll Out; there were several criteria used to determine this list including funding status, location, mobilizer strength, and coalition readiness to begin this process; sites were allowed to select who would attend the Facilitator training so some opted for more than one participant
